DEFM14A: Iris Acquisition Corp. Seeks Stockholder Approval for Liminatus Pharma Merger
Definitive Proxy Statement
Iris Acquisition Corp. is asking its stockholders to approve a business combination with Liminatus Pharma, a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company.
Summary
- Iris Acquisition Corp. (IRAA) is seeking stockholder approval for a business combination with Liminatus Pharma, LLC.
- The proposed transaction involves Liminatus Merger Sub merging into Liminatus, and SPAC Merger Sub merging into Iris, with Iris surviving as a subsidiary of ParentCo.
- The aggregate consideration for the transaction is 25.0 million shares of ParentCo common stock, valued at $10.00 per share.
- Stockholders will vote on proposals including the business combination, issuance of ParentCo stock, an incentive plan, and charter amendments.
- The Special Meeting of stockholders will be held virtually on August 29, 2024.
- Liminatus Members will own approximately 70.6% of the combined voting power of ParentCo Common Stock, assuming no redemptions.
- The Iris Board unanimously recommends voting FOR the Business Combination Proposal and other proposals.

Risks
- The success of Liminatus depends on the success of the Liminatus assets, and its anticipated clinical trials of the Liminatus assets may not be successful.
- Liminatus will need substantial additional funds to advance development of product candidates and its GCC cancer vaccine, and it cannot guarantee that it will have sufficient funds available in the future to develop and commercialize its current or potential future product candidates and technologies.
- If Liminatus is unable to raise capital when needed, or on acceptable terms, it may be forced to delay, reduce and/or eliminate one or more of its development programs or future commercialization efforts.
- The Sponsor, Iriss directors and executive officers, and their affiliates, own interests in Iris that will be worthless if the transactions are not approved, which may have influenced their decisions.
- The terms of the Business Combination Agreement provide that Iris will not have any surviving remedies against Liminatus or its equityholders after the closing to recover for losses as a result of any inaccuracies or breaches of Liminatuss representations, warranties, or covenants set forth in the Business Combination Agreement.
- The potential that a significant number of Iriss stockholders elect to redeem their shares prior to the consummation of the Business Combination, which would reduce the amount of cash available following the closing.
- The risk that the Transactions might not be consummated or completed in a timely manner or that the closing might not occur despite Iriss best efforts, including by reason of a failure to obtain the approval of Iriss stockholders, litigation challenging the Business Combination or that an adverse judgment granting permanent injunctive relief could indefinitely enjoin the consummation of the Business Combination.

Management Changes
| Role | Previous Person | New Person | Effective Date | Reason |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Chief Executive Officer | Sumit Mehta | Chris Kim | Closing of the Business Combination | Change in management following the Business Combination |
| Chief Financial Officer | Lisha Parmar | Scott Dam | Closing of the Business Combination | Change in management following the Business Combination |
| Chief Science Officer | NA | Byong C. Yoo, PhD | Closing of the Business Combination | New position following the Business Combination |
| Head of Research & Development | NA | Sang-jin Daniel Lee, PhD | Closing of the Business Combination | New position following the Business Combination |
| Chief Technology Officer | NA | Beom K. Choi | Closing of the Business Combination | New position following the Business Combination |
Corporate Governance
| Change Type | Description | Effective Date | Impact Assessment |
|---|---|---|---|
| Board Composition | The ParentCo Board will consist of three members, with two members designated by Liminatus and one member designated by Iris. | Closing of the Business Combination | May impact the balance of power and decision-making within the board. |
| Board Classification | The ParentCo Board will be divided into three classes with staggered three-year terms. | Closing of the Business Combination | May delay or prevent a change of management or a change in control. |

Key Dates
| Date | Description |
|---|---|
| November 5, 2020 | Iris Acquisition Corp incorporated in Delaware. |
| March 4, 2021 | Registration statement for Iriss IPO declared effective. |
| March 9, 2021 | Iris consummated its initial public offering (IPO). |
| November 30, 2022 | Iris entered into a Business Combination Agreement with Liminatus Pharma, LLC. |
| December 20, 2022 | Iris filed an amendment to the Iris Certificate of Incorporation to change the date by which the Company must consummate a business combination from March 9, 2023 to June 9, 2023. |
| May 30, 2023 | The Board held a meeting and extended the date by which the Company must consummate a Business Combination for a three month period from June 9, 2023 to September 9, 2023. |
| June 1, 2023 | The parties to the Business Combination Agreement amended the Business Combination Agreement to extend the Outside Date from June 7, 2023, to September 30, 2023. |
| August 14, 2023 | The parties to the Business Combination Agreement amended the Business Combination Agreement to extend the Outside Date from September 30, 2023 to March 9, 2024. |
| September 7, 2023 | The Company, filed an amendment to the Iris Certificate of Incorporation with the Secretary of State of the State of Delaware to change the date by which the Company must consummate a business combination from September 9, 2023 to December 9, 2023. |
| December 5, 2023 | The Board held a meeting and extended the date by which the Company must consummate a Business Combination for a three month period from December 9, 2023 to March 9, 2024. |
| March 7, 2024 | The Companys stockholders approved the amendment to the Iris Certificate of Incorporation at the special meeting. |
| March 9, 2024 | The parties to the Business Combination Agreement amended the Business Combination Agreement to extend the Outside Date from March 9, 2024 to July 31, 2024. |
| May 13, 2024 | The Iris Board extended the date by which the Company must consummate a Business Combination for a three month period from June 9, 2024 to September 9, 2024. |
| July 19, 2024 | The parties to the Business Combination Agreement amended the Business Combination Agreement to extend the Outside Date from July 31, 2024 to September 3, 2024. |
| August 1, 2024 | Record date for the Special Meeting. |
| August 9, 2024 | Date of notice of Special Meeting of Stockholders of Iris Acquisition Corp. |
| August 22, 2024 | Deadline to request documents from Iris to receive them before the Special Meeting. |
| August 27, 2024 | Deadline to submit a written request to the Transfer Agent that Iris redeem your public shares for cash. |
| August 29, 2024 | Special Meeting of Iris Stockholders to be held. |
| September 3, 2024 | Outside Date for consummation of the Business Combination. |
| September 9, 2024 | If we do not consummate a business combination or amend the Iris Certificate of Incorporation by stockholder approval by September 9, 2024, we will be required to dissolve and liquidate the Trust Account by returning the then remaining funds in such Trust Account to our public stockholders. |
